Subject: DR drill Thursday — Pellwort sweeper restore

Hi on-call,

This Thursday we run the quarterly disaster-recovery drill for Pellwort, the data-retention sweeper. At 10:00 we will simulate loss of the primary region and you will restore the sweeper's state store from the cold snapshot, then re-run one retention cycle against the staging tenants. Expect the whole exercise to take under two hours. The restored vault will prompt for an unseal credential; for the drill, use the recovery passphrase below.

unlock words, kagef-taduf: fenir-quenix-norwyn-sorvan-gormir-gorir-fraok

Rate-parity checker (Brightmoor)

The parity checker scrapes posted room rates across partner feeds and flags deltas over 2% against our Brightmoor contract rate. Review focus: the comparator in `parity/core`, currency normalization, and the dedupe pass. Scrapes run hourly; results land in the parity queue. Local runs need access to the feeds aggregator, which is internal-only. The test harness authenticates to the aggregator with the key below.

service key, fawip-bajef: kto11_Qt5wZK9vdNC

Handover note — Crumbwheel order cutoffs.

Welcome aboard. The bakery cutoff rule in Crumbwheel closes same-day orders at 14:00 local to each storefront, not UTC — this has bitten us twice. Holiday overrides live in the calendar service and take precedence silently, so always check there first when a cutoff looks wrong. To unlock the calendar service's admin console after a restart, enter the recovery passphrase below.

vault phrase of bagap-bahaf = silion-pelox-sorox-casdor-quenwyn-fraax-eliox-praael-kelion-quenvan-kasox-rusael-norius-belvan

## Deployment

Before deploying Meridel's sync worker, note that the calendar conflict resolver now runs as a pre-flight step. If two upstream calendars claim the same slot, the resolver defers to the source with the newer etag rather than failing the whole batch, which previously caused silent drops during the Ostrava-region rollout. Reviewers should confirm the resolver flag is enabled in both staging and production, since a mismatch reintroduces the race. The worker reads its settings at startup from the values below.

deployment values, faduf-tawep:
SORDOR_LOG_LEVEL=error
SORDOR_METRICS_HOST=metrics.sordor.nelvrolabs.internal
SORDOR_POOL_SIZE=4